Tip #3: Choose High-Protein Foods
Eating high-protein foods can help boost your metabolism because protein requires more energy to digest than carbs or fats. This means that your body works harder to break down protein, burning more calories in the process.
Plus, protein can help you feel more satisfied after meals, which can help you avoid snacking on unhealthy foods between meals. Here’s a helpful visual to remind you to choose high-protein foods:.
Tip #4: Do Strength Training
Strength training is another way to help boost your metabolism. When you do strength training exercises like lifting weights or using resistance bands, you’re building lean muscle mass.
Muscle burns more calories than fat, so the more muscle you have, the more calories you’ll burn throughout the day – even when you’re just sitting still. Here’s a helpful visual to remind you to incorporate strength training into your workout routine:.
